Kornblau Ties Program’s Career Home Run Record in Doubleheader Split with St. Lawrence
CANTON, N.Y. – The Plattsburgh State baseball team split a non-conference doubleheader against St. Lawrence on Wednesday afternoon, winning game one 10-9, before falling 9-0 in game two. The Cards came back from a six-run deficit to win game one, as Alex Kornblau (Pound Ridge, N.Y./Fox Lane) tied the program record for career homers with his 11 th career blast. Kornblau finished the day 4-6 with two RBI, three runs scored, a stolen base, and two walks, while Austin Caldwell (Clifton Park, N.Y./Shenendehowa) also had four hits with two doubles and a run scored.
